    RIYADH, Saudi Arabia, Sept. 10, 2025 /PRNewswire/ — Phoenix Contact, a global leader in industrial automation and connectivity solutions, proudly announces the establishment of Phoenix Contact Trading LLC in Riyadh, Saudi Arabia. Founded in 2024, this strategic expansion marks a significant milestone in the company’s commitment to deepening its presence in the region and aligning with Saudi Arabia’s dynamic economic and industrial transformation.

    The new entity enables Phoenix Contact to engage more closely with the Saudi market, delivering tailored products and services that meet local needs and support national development initiatives. The company’s collaboration with trusted local partners has been instrumental in launching operations, leveraging their expertise to drive innovation, infrastructure support, and the adoption of localized solutions.

    A cornerstone of Phoenix Contact’s strategy in the Kingdom is the development of local talent. Through targeted training programs, career development initiatives, and knowledge exchange, the company aims to foster long-term growth that reflects the ambitions and capabilities of the Saudi workforce.

    Phoenix Contact Trading LLC offers a comprehensive portfolio of components and system solutions for energy generation, transportation, and distribution, as well as for device manufacturing, machine building, and control cabinet construction. The product range includes:

    • Modular and specialized terminal blocks
    • PCB connectors and cable connection technology
    • Installation accessories and electronic interfaces
    • Power supplies and automation systems based on Ethernet and wireless technologies
    • Open control systems, safety solutions, and surge protection systems

    These solutions empower system installers, operators, and infrastructure developers across industrial, urban, and transportation sectors.

    As a pioneer in digital transformation, Phoenix Contact integrates its deep experience in in-house machine building to support seamless data flow across the entire product lifecycle—from engineering and production to installation and maintenance.

    With a strong foundation in Saudi Arabia, Phoenix Contact remains committed to sustainable development, customer-centric innovation, and empowering the future of industry in the Kingdom.
